    Unable to open AI files at AutoLaser

    Hi all, I have a new Redsail X700 with AutoLaser V2.1.7 but the AutoLaser program unable to open AI files (Adobe Illustrator CS6).
    Anyone can help? Thanks.....

    Re: Unable to open AI files at AutoLaser

    Hi Frankie.
    I have also not been able to open .ai files. I end up having to open them in illustrator and then use the plugin.

    One note on that, the plugin only works if AutoLaser is not running. Also, the plugin doesn't open Illustrator properly. So you may need to run the plugin then manually open AutoLaser and you will see the exported data. Kinda wonky.

    Re: Unable to open AI files at AutoLaser

    Another option is to export to a "dxf" file, this should be readable by nearly every CNC CAM program even by AutoLaser.

    Before exporting, make sure you do not have filled surfaces, only lines, make sure that the colors are correct, each color could be generate a different layer in the CAM system, depending on the CAM System.
    At the DXF export options it is usualy the best to have text converted to curves, choose the same unit setting (mm, cm ....) that is selected for importing in the CAM system (AutoLaser...)
